Subject: Cachewell cut-over done — postmortem follow-up

Team,

Cut-over finished 06:40. The stale-cache bug traced to the Bramford edge tier serving expired entries after TTL rollover; fix shipped and verified. No data exposure found, but please review the invalidation path as part of your audit. Old cache nodes are drained and will be decommissioned Friday. Monitoring added for TTL skew. Full postmortem doc circulates tomorrow. For your review, the production cache tier now runs with the following settings.

settings of tagef-bawif:
DRUIX_HOST=druix.zemvarlabs.internal
DRUIX_PORT=8000

## BranchReaper Account Recovery

If the BranchReaper bot at Quellware loses its service account (usually after a quarterly credential rotation), do not re-provision from scratch. First pause the cleanup queue so no stale branches are deleted mid-recovery, then confirm the bot's identity in the Vexhall admin console. Recovery requires the team passphrase held in the on-call vault; enter it exactly, including spacing. The current recovery passphrase is shown below.

vault phrase of baduf-tagep = fraael-ulawyn

# Formula Sandbox Service Accounts

User-supplied formulas in Calcrest run inside the Penhollow sandbox under the `formula-runner` service account. No network egress, 256 MB memory cap, 2s CPU budget. If the sandbox pool is exhausted, drain and restart via `penctl pool recycle`. Do not widen the account's scopes during an incident; escalate to the Marlowe rotation instead. The sandbox broker authenticates with the key below.

gateway credential: kto23_LX9A4ys6i4nzHtpOLNLodKK

## Break-Glass: Queue Migration (Snagglewood → Ferrovia)

Quick note for the security review: while we replace the homegrown Snagglewood job queue with Ferrovia, break-glass access lets on-call drain stuck jobs from the old tables directly. It's time-boxed, fully logged, and goes away once cutover finishes. Unsealing the drain tooling requires the recovery passphrase listed here:

strongbox words: prawyn-fenmir